The Domino Effect of a Bent Rim
A bent rim can lead to a series of events that may seem insignificant at first but can ultimately result in a costly and time-consuming ordeal. Here’s a breakdown of the potential consequences:
- Alignment Issues: A bent rim can cause your tire to become misaligned, which can lead to uneven tire wear, reduced fuel efficiency, and even damage to your vehicle’s suspension system.
- Tire Wear and Tear: Uneven tire wear can cause your tire to wear down faster, reducing its lifespan and increasing the risk of a blowout on the road.
- Reduced Traction: A bent rim can also reduce your vehicle’s traction, making it more difficult to stop or accelerate, especially on slippery roads.
- Increased Maintenance Costs: As the domino effect continues, you may need to replace your tire, wheel bearings, or even your entire suspension system, which can be a costly and time-consuming process.

The Science Behind a Bent Rim
When a rim becomes bent, it can disrupt the delicate balance of your vehicle’s suspension system. The rim acts as a mounting point for your tire, and when it’s bent, it can cause the tire to become misaligned. This misalignment can lead to uneven tire wear, which can cause the tire to wear down faster, reducing its lifespan.
But it’s not just the tire that suffers. A bent rim can also cause the wheel bearings to work harder, leading to increased wear and tear on these critical components. This can result in a decrease in traction, making it more difficult to stop or accelerate.

The Risks of a Bent Rim
A bent rim can cause more problems than you think. Even if the damage appears minor, it can lead to a range of issues that might compromise your tire’s safety and longevity. Let’s start with the basics: what exactly happens when a rim gets bent?
- Uneven Tire Wear: A bent rim can cause the tire to wear unevenly, leading to reduced traction and potentially increasing the risk of a blowout.
- Tire Imbalance: When a rim is bent, it can create an imbalance in the tire’s rotation, leading to vibrations and uneven wear.
- Increased Stress on the Tire: A bent rim can put additional stress on the tire, causing it to degrade faster and potentially leading to a blowout.
- Reduced Tire Pressure: A bent rim can cause the tire to lose pressure, even if you’re not driving, due to the increased stress on the tire.

What Causes a Bent Rim?
A bent rim is often the result of a road hazard, such as a pothole or a curb, that comes into contact with the tire. When this happens, the force exerted on the rim can cause it to bend or warp, leading to a potentially costly repair. However, it’s essential to note that not all bent rims are created equal. Some may be more severe than others, and the severity of the bend can greatly impact the tire’s integrity.
The Anatomy of a Bent Rim
A bent rim can take on various forms, but it’s typically characterized by a curvature or deformation of the rim’s shape. This curvature can be in the form of a concave or convex shape, and it can occur in different areas of the rim, such as the center, the edge, or the lip. The severity of the bend will determine the extent of the damage to the tire.

Q: What are the costs associated with repairing a bent rim?
The cost of repairing a bent rim can vary depending on the extent of the damage and the type of repair required. On average, a bent rim repair can cost anywhere from $50 to $200, depending on the complexity of the repair. To give you a better estimate, here are some typical costs associated with repairing a bent rim: wheel straightening ($50-$100), wheel refinishing ($50-$100), and wheel balancing ($20-$50).

When a rim is bent, it creates uneven contact between the tire and the wheel. This can lead to several issues, including:
– Uneven Wear: The tire starts to wear down in certain areas, which can reduce its lifespan and compromise its performance.
– Vibration: The bent rim causes the tire to vibrate, leading to an uncomfortable ride and potential damage to the vehicle’s suspension.
– Heat Buildup: The uneven contact can cause the tire to overheat, which can lead to a blowout or other catastrophic failures.These problems can be costly to repair and even lead to safety issues on the road. So, what can you do to prevent a bent rim from messing up your tire?
